NLU 101: Introduction to Natural Language Understanding
Posted on October 11, 2022, Level beginner Resource Length medium
Natural Language Understanding (NLU) is a subtopic of Natural Language Processing. It focuses on "comprehension". NLU deals with users' intents and what they mean instead of what they say. Thus, some people refer to it as Intent Detection or Intent Detector. By picovoice.ai.

Implement step-up authentication with Amazon Cognito
Posted on September 25, 2022, Level intermediate Resource Length medium
In this blog post, you'll learn how to protect privileged business transactions that are exposed as APIs by using multi-factor authentication (MFA) or security challenges. These challenges have two components: what you know (such as passwords), and what you have (such as a one-time password token). By using these multi-factor security controls, you can implement step-up authentication to obtain a higher level of security when you perform critical transactions.
